Description

From the Pinkham Notch visitors center, near the exit of the Sherburne Trail, follow trail signs to the Gulf Of Slides Trail.

This trail is a bit longer and harder than the Sherbie, you will need to cross a few rivers, especially in early season.

The biggest of these crossings is at the very bottom.

When ascending, keep your eyes on the woods to lookers left for a short cut.

This skirts a few switchbacks on a somewhat unofficial trail, keep in mind you can not ski back down this way.

Follow the trail until you cross a large drainage, this will give you your first view of GOS, in a zone called, The Fingers.

to get to the main gullies, continue be up the trail.

There is a small rescue cache, then the trail terminates right below, Gully #1.

You can ski down from here, or do some exploring in the high alpine of Gulf Of Slides.

The ski down is very exciting and a little more dynamic than the Sherbie.
